What happens in the beginning of Tomorrow, When the War Began?

In a small Australian town, seven teenage friends go on a camping trip to be with nature. During their trip, they see military aircraft fly overhead. What they don’t know is that their country is being invaded. Returning home, they discover that they are at war.

What happens to Corrie and Kevin in Tomorrow, When the War Began?





Kevin takes Corrie to the hospital and refuses to leave her side, despite the obvious threat to his own safety, which is evidence of the deep love and loyalty he clearly feels for her. Corrie also represents the loss of innocence in Marsden’s novel.

What happens to Homer in Tomorrow, When the War Began?

However, as soon as the war breaks out, Homer emerges as the unofficial leader of their group. Ellie describes Homer’s transformation into a responsible adult as one of the greatest surprises of her life, which speaks to just how much Homer changes during the war.

What is the climax of tomorrow when the war began?

In a harrowing scene, Homer, Ellie, Fi, and Lee successfully blow up the bridge thanks to some solid planning, some good luck, and some stick-to-itiveness on Ellie’s part. This is definitely the climax because it is the most action packed, scary, and exciting moment of the entire book.

How does Fiona change in tomorrow when the war began?

She is beautiful and delicate, and Ellie and the others think she is “perfect.” Fiona’s life of privilege means that she is rather sheltered, but she still manages to adapt to the stress of the war and mature like the rest of the group.
